Of Note: Became the 24th UW player to record 1,000 career points, hitting the grand mark against Iowa on Jan. 13 ... ranks 19th in career points with 1,213 ... ranks first in career 3-point percentage at .409 (235-of-574) ... ranks third in career triples made at 235 ... ranks fourth in 3-pointers attempted with 574 ... UW Big Ten-season record holder for 3-pointers made (61) and percentage (.508), set in 2014-15 ... set UW single season record for 3-point percentage (.488) and ranks second for triples made (81) as a junior

Honors: 2015 Honorable Mention All-Big Ten ... 2015 Academic All-Big Ten ... Big Ten Co-Freshman of the Week, Dec. 10, 2012

2015-16: Has played and started all 29 games ... averaging 35.2 minutes per game which leads the team ... leads the Badgers with 15.1 points per game, which ranks 20th in the Big Ten ... has scored in double figures in 22 games ... has led the team in scoring in a team-high 15 games ... tied her career-high with three blocks and scored her season best of 25 points against Minnesota (Jan. 23) ... scored a season-high 24 points at San Diego State (Nov. 29) and vs. Indiana (Dec. 31) ... scored in double figures in eight straight games from Nov. 27 - Dec. 31 and 10 straight games from Jan. 10 - Feb. 11 ... leads the team and ties for fifth in the Big Ten with 2.6 triples made per game ... tied a school record by going 5-of-5 from behind the arc against Northern Illinois (Dec. 16) ... shoots a team-best .900 (54-of-60) from the free-throw line ... shot a perfect 1.000 (3-3) from the line against Michigan (Feb. 11) and against Northwestern (Feb. 20) going 5-of-5 ... leads the Badgers with 1.5 steals per game ... had a season-high four steals in two games ... has led the team in steals in six games ... ranks second on the squad with 3.9 assists per game ... tied her career high with nine assists vs. Penn State (Jan. 10) ... has led the squad in assists in 13 games ... adds 3.9 rebounds per game ... tied her career best 10 rebounds at Nebraska (Jan. 27) ... is second on the team with 25 blocks (0.9/game) ... tied her career best with three blocks vs. La Tech (Nov. 14) and vs. Delaware (Nov. 27) ... leads the team with 16 leading scoring finishes and 22 double digit scoring efforts ... scored all 12 points for the Badgers in the second quarter against Michigan State (Jan. 31) marking the fifth time shes scored 10 or more points in a single period

2014-15: Played and started 27 games, averaging a team-high 34.5 minutes per game ... missed two games with an ankle injury ... led the team and ranked 11th in the Big Ten with 15.3 points per game ... most improved scorer in the Big Ten, upping her average by 9.2 points per game from last season ... scored in double figures in 23 games ... led the team in scoring in 13 games ... had a career-high 31 points against Ohio State (Jan. 29) ... hit 11-of-19 from the field against the Buckeyes, including 8-of-11 from 3-point range ... triples made set a school and Kohl Center single game record ... set the UW Big Ten-season record for 3-pointers made at 61 and percentage at .508 ... set UW single season record for 3-point percentage (.488) ... ranked first in the Big Ten and second nationally in triple percentage ... ranks second on UW single season record for triples made (81) ... ranked third in the Big Ten and ninth nationally in 3-pointers made ... added 4.0 rebounds per game ... had a season-high nine rebounds against Maryland (Feb. 19) ... led the team and ranked 14th in the Big Ten with 3.8 assists per game (103 total) ... had a career-high nine assists vs. Illinois State (Nov. 16) ... ranked third on the team with 28 steals (1.0/game) ... ranked third on the team in free throws made (34), hitting 74.5 percent from the line

2013-14: Played in 28 games, starting 13, averaging 24.2 minutes per game ... ranked sixth on the team with 6.1 points per game ... scored in double figures in six games ... tallied a season high 17 points at Penn State (Feb. 16), hitting 6-of-10 from the field, including 5-of-8 from 3-point range ... hit a 35-foot 3-pointer with one second remaining to send the Green Bay (Dec. 30) game into overtime ... led the Badgers with a .388 3-point field goal percentage, which ranked seventh in the Big Ten ... averaged 1.7 3-pointers per game in Big Ten play, which ranked 14th in the conference ... added 2.2 rebounds per game ... had a season-high six boards vs. Minnesota (March 6) in the first round of the Big Ten Tournament ... led the team with 2.36 assists per game ... dished off a season-best seven dimes at Illinois (Jan. 3) ... also played a season-high 38 minutes vs. the Illini ... tied her career best by going 4-of-4 from the free throw line vs. Mercer (Nov. 29)

2012-13: Played in 29 games, starting 24, and averaged 26.7 minutes a game ... missed the Big Ten Tournament due to illness ... earned first career start at Virginia Tech (Nov. 28) ... averaged 7.0 points and 3.6 rebounds per game ... scored in double figures in nine games ... scored a season-high 16 points vs. Marquette (Dec. 5) ... added a career-high five steals against the Golden Eagles ... named Big Ten Co-Freshman of the Week after her performance against Marquette ... recorded 12 points and seven rebounds at Northwestern (Feb. 23) ... scored 14 points against Illinois (Feb. 18) and against Purdue (Feb. 14) ... scored 15 points on a season-high 4-of-4 free throws against Iowa (Jan. 10) ... scored 15 points against Eastern Illinois (Dec. 15) ... scored 11 points against Alabama (Dec. 1), shooting a perfect 4-of-4 from the floor and 3-of-3 from 3-point range ... scored 10 points on 3-of-6 shooting vs. Milwaukee (Nov. 11) ... played a season-high 37 minutes in three games ... had a career-high 10 rebounds at Ohio State (Feb. 7) ... averaged 1.2 assists per game ... had a season-high three assists in five games ... added 0.9 steals per game ... had a career-high three blocks vs. Florida Atlantic (Dec. 10) ... averaged 0.5 blocks per game

High School: 2012 Gatorade Player of the Year for the state of Wisconsin ... 2012 Wisconsin Basketball Coaches Association Miss Basketball ... two-time unanimous selection to the WBCA Division 2 All-State team ... 2011 and 2012 Woodland Conference Player of the Year for Coach Gary Schmidt at New Berlin Eisenhower High School ... three-time first-team all-conference ... two-time first-team all-area honors by the Milwaukee Journal-Sentinel, all-county honors by the Waukesha Freeman and all-suburban honors by Community Newspapers ... averaged 17 points, 5.2 rebounds, 5.2 assists, 3.1 steals per game as a senior ... also shot 44 percent from 3-point range and 80 percent from the free throw line ... as a junior, averaged 15.5 points, 4.7 rebounds, 5.4 assists and 2.9 steals per game, leading Eisenhower to a 23-3 record

Personal: Parents are Chris and Kathy Bauman ... has one sister Emily (24) ... born Jan. 28 ... major is business
